WebJul 12, 2024 · To shutdown and power-off the centos 7 or rhel 7 system, issue the following command, type: systemctl poweroff This command not only shutdown the system, but also prints a wall message to all users that are currently logged into the system. WebIn RHEL 7, run levels have been replaced with systemd target units. Target units have a .target extension and similar to run levels, target units allow you to start a system with only the services that are required for a specific purpose.
WebNov 22, 2024 · Check System Messages. You can further correlate the reboot you want to diagnose with system messages. For CentOS/RHEL systems, you’ll find the logs at /var/log/messages while for Ubuntu/Debian systems, its logged at /var/log/syslog.
